Organizational Intelligence Developing Industry-Unique Decision Support and Business Intelligence Module

Portland, OR, March 27, 2007 — Organizational Intelligence (OI), a Portland-based provider of healthcare business intelligence solutions, working in conjunction with Iowa Health in Des Moines, is developing a unique approach for accessing key performance metrics. The new module should be available in about three months. The OI software, which is entirely browser-based, will utilize an industry-unique user interface to allow clients to access their decision making data. The new OI module will be a fully customizable executive and manager dashboard of quantitative and qualitative key performance metrics which can be completely customized by each client to support their organizational needs and strategic objectives. In addition to the typical financial metrics, the new module will include performance metrics from operations, such as employee satisfaction, which are important to the entire management team. It is being designed to graphically highlight problem areas based on pre-determined targets and variance sensitivities that each client can specify.

The module will provide executives and departmental managers with real-time data and trending capabilities. The module’s views will be entirely specific to each client and will include user-defined automated alerts. Other features to be included are full drill-down capability and integration with other OI modules. All OI business intelligence software modules were developed using MS SQL Server and .NET.
